Nestled in Southampton, St Denys train station is a welcoming gateway to the south of England. Whether you’re a daily commuter or an occasional traveler, this station offers a modest but vital hub of connectivity for numerous destinations, making it a pivotal starting point for your journeys.
St Denys station boasts a variety of essential facilities designed to enhance your travel experience. Ticketing is straightforward, with a ticket office open during weekday mornings and accessible ticket machines that cater to everyone, including disc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ders. Those who prefer to purchase in advance will be pleased to know that tickets booked online can be conveniently collected from these machines.
While the station does not offer a waiting room or refreshment facilities, it provides seating areas and step-free access to some parts, ensuring a degree of comfort and mobility for all passengers. Assistance with boarding is available from the onboard Guard, though planning ahead and using booking services is advisable.
Security is a priority too; with CCTV in operation, passengers can have peace of mind while waiting for their trains. However, it’s worth noting that facilities such as luggage storage and shops are not available, so come prepared.
Connected well by road and rail, St Denys extends its convenience beyond the station limits. For those traveling by bus, information for planning your journey is accessible and can be printed here. While there aren't any cycle hire services, cyclists have access to racks for securing bicycles, although not under shelter.
For passengers affected by rail disruptions, a replacement service is accessible from Belmont Road, facilitating a smooth transition between modes of transport without straying too far from the station’s precincts.

When it comes to traveling across the UK by train, Wolverhampton Train Station stands out as a bustling hub of activity. Whether you're a seasoned commuter or a first-time visitor, the station provides seamless travel experiences. Located in the West Midlands, it offers impressive facilities, efficient connections, and is a gateway to exploring major cities and quaint destinations. Let's delve into the specifics of what makes Wolverhampton Station a significant stop on your journey.
Wolverhampton Train Station is equipped with an array of facilities to make your visit as comfortable as possible. Ticket purchasing is a breeze with an accessible ticket office open from 05:30 to 22:30 on weekdays and slightly reduced hours on Sundays. Ticket machines are available to collect tickets bought online, though they are not currently accessible for those with disabilities. For those needing additional support, the station boasts an induction loop, staffed assistance points throughout the station, and CCTV for added safety.
Accessibility is a priority at the station, which is classified as a step-free access category A station. This means all platforms are accessible without steps, which is great news for travelers with mobility concerns. The station also offers 27 accessible parking spaces. However, it's important to note that there are no smartcard facilities, so you’ll need to bring your ticket or collect it from the machines.
Travelers can relax in the comfortable waiting areas or enjoy a moment in the first-class lounge if you have the appropriate ticket. Refreshment facilities are conveniently located throughout the station to grab a bite or a coffee on the go, and ATMs are also available.
Getting around from Wolverhampton is simple, given the transport links and options available right outside the station. The West Midlands Metro tram services are a quick and efficient option for leading you smoothly into nearby destinations. Rail replacement services run from directly opposite the station entrance, ensuring continuity of travel even during disruptions.
If you're planning on catching a bus, a wealth of information is accessible for planning your journey via printable formats. Wolverhampton station does not yet offer underground services, but this is made up for with the efficient availability of trams and buses.
